Mad Honey: The Dangerous Hunting Culture (2024)

Mad Honey, harvested from Nepal’s Himalayan cliffs, has been an integral part of local culture for millennia. Known for its psychological effects from grayanotoxin, consumption in small quantities can induce well-being, while larger doses risk hallucinations and dizziness. It’s used medicinally and recreationally, valued for both its aphrodisiac and psychedelic properties. This rare honey’s fame is derived from its ancient roots, unique taste, and the daring methods of its harvest. The Gurung people, traditional honey hunters, respect and ritually honor the bees.
